Latest Patents

Thanh Du holds a patent for a "Test handler head having reverse funnel design." This invention features a test head for a semiconductor device handler that includes a plunger and a funnel insert attached to the plunger via a funnel insert spring. The funnel insert is designed with a channel extending axially through it and includes a plurality of sloped inner walls that are configured to contact the upper edges of a semiconductor device. This design centers the semiconductor device within the funnel insert, enhancing the handling process. The plunger also includes a projecting portion that extends through the channel of the funnel insert, ensuring optimal functionality.
